Introduction This multi-part deliverable (Release 1) defines a satellite radio int

37、erface that provides UMTS services to users of mobile terminals via geostationary (GEO) satellites in the frequency range 1 518,000 MHz to 1 559,000 MHz (downlink) and 1 626,500 MHz to 1 660,500 MHz and 1 668,000 MHz to 1 675,000 MHz (uplink). ETSI ETSI TS 102 744-3-9 V1.1.1 (2015-10) 7 1 Scope The

38、present document defines the necessary control plane behaviour for instantiation and initiation of the User Plane entities, and also describes the operation of the User Plane entities for the Family SL satellite radio interface between the Radio Network Controller (RNC) and the User Equipment (UE) u

39、sed in the satellite network. 2 References 2.1 Normative references References are either specific (identified by date of publication and/or edition number or version number) or non-specific.
